Water Agencies (Powers) Act 1984
Water Agencies (Charges) Amendment
By-laws (No. 4) 1998
Made by the Minister under section 34(1) of the Act.
1. Citation
These by-laws may be cited as the Water Agencies (Charges)
Amendment By-laws (No. 4) 1998.
2. Commencement
These by-laws come into operation immediately after the
commencement of the Water Agencies (Charges) Amendment
By-laws (No. 2) 1998.
3. The by-laws amended
The amendments in these by-laws are to the Water Agencies
(Charges) By-laws 1987*.
[* Reprinted as at 25 August 1997.For amendments to 29 June 1998 see 1997 Index to
Legislation of Western Australia, Table 4, p. 292, and
Gazettes 6 January, 9 April and 26 June 1998.]
4. Schedule 2 amended
Schedule 2 is amended in the Table to item 3 of Part 2 by
deleting the line commencing “Mandurah (1/7/98 Values)” and
inserting instead —
“
Mandurah (1/7/98 Values) 7.322 4.739 ”.
KIM HAMES, Minister for Water Resources.
